The establishment of the District Assembly Common Fund (DACF) in 1993 and concomitant percentage set aside for Members of Parliament (MPs) in 2004 aims to support local governments and legislators in pro-poor development activities in their communities and constituencies. The 1992 Constitution of the Republic of Ghana, in Article 240, tasks them, the local government authorities (Metropolitan, Municipal, and District Assemblies — MMDAs) to plan, initiate, co-ordinate, manage and execute policies in respect of all matters affecting the people within their areas. In 2018, RUWA-GHANA did a cursory study of all the Metropolitan, Municipal, and District Assemblies (MMDAs) in the Northern region of Ghana and realized that most of the assemblies did not have women representatives who stood for elections and won; rather the presence of some women in the assemblies was on the benevolence of the president's appointment. Analyzing data from Afrobarometer surveys and 100 interviews, the article establishes that DCEs' position is very complex, involving the exercise of political and administrative functions aimed to influence grassroots support for the president. Ghana also has a network of regional coordinating councils (RCCs), which comprise representatives from the district assemblies and traditional authorities in the region, and are chaired by regional ministers.
